Concrete foundation repair services involve assessing and restoring the structural integrity of a building’s base. Over time, foundations can develop issues such as cracks, settling, or shifting due to soil movement, moisture changes, or poor initial construction. Professional contractors use specialized techniques to identify the root causes of foundation problems and implement solutions like underpinning, slab jacking, or piering. These repairs help stabilize the structure, prevent further damage, and ensure the safety and longevity of the property.

Many foundation problems are caused by soil expansion and contraction, water infiltration, or uneven settling. Cracks in walls or floors, sticking doors or windows, and uneven flooring are common signs that a foundation may need attention. Left unaddressed, these issues can lead to more serious structural damage, including collapsed walls or compromised support systems. Foundation repair services are designed to address these problems early, helping to preserve the property’s value and prevent costly future repairs.

Properties that typically require foundation repair include single-family homes, townhouses, and small commercial buildings. Homes built on expansive clay soil or areas prone to frequent moisture fluctuations are especially susceptible to foundation issues. Older properties with signs of shifting or cracking often benefit from professional assessment and repair. The overview below groups typical Concrete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Orange County, FL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or foundation repairs in Orange County range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as crack filling or small stabilization jobs, fall within this range. Larger or more involved repairs can exceed this, but most projects stay in the lower to mid-tier costs.

Moderate Repairs - For more substantial foundation issues like significant cracks or minor settling, local contractors often charge between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common and usually involve more extensive work than basic repairs but remain manageable within this range.

Major Repair Projects - Larger, more complex foundation stabilization or underpinning work typically costs between $4,000 and $8,000. While fewer projects reach this tier, they are necessary for serious foundation concerns requiring significant intervention.

Full Foundation Replacement - Complete foundation replacement in the Orange County area can range from $10,000 to $30,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ity of the project. Most full replacements are at the higher end, but many projects fall into mid-range estimates based on scope and conditions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What signs indicate a need for concrete foundation repair? Common ind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ly.

How do local contractors typically repair concrete foundations? They may use methods such as mudjacking, underpinning, or piering to stabilize and restore the foundation’s integrity.

Is foundation repair necessary if there are minor cracks? Minor cracks can sometimes be cosmetic, but it’s advisable to have a professional assessment to determine if repair is needed to prevent further damage.

What causes the need for concrete foundation repair in Orange County, FL? Factors like soil movement, moisture fluctuations, and nearby construction can contribute to foundation issues requiring repair.
